Safety Information

Always read the safety instructions before operating the snow blower. Wear appropriate clothing and safety gear, and ensure the area is clear of obstacles.

  1. Keep hands and feet away from moving parts.
  2. Do not operate in enclosed spaces.
  3. Check fuel levels before starting.
  4. Never leave the machine running unattended.

WARNING! Failure to follow safety instructions may result in serious injury.

Operation Instructions

To operate the snow blower, follow these steps:

  1. Ensure the area is clear of debris.
  2. Start the engine using the electric start feature.
  3. Adjust the chute direction as needed.
  4. Use the speed control to set your desired speed.
  5. Begin clearing snow in a straight line.

CAUTION! Always be aware of your surroundings while operating.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Engine won't startFuel issueCheck fuel levels and ensure proper fuel is used.
Snow not clearingClogged chuteClear any blockages in the chute.
Strange noisesLoose partsInspect for loose components and tighten as necessary.
Excessive vibrationWorn beltsCheck and replace worn belts.
